Red Gregory Profile

Red Gregory is a 8 year old bay gelding. Red Gregory is trained by Kylie Goater, at Kalgoorlie and owned by Mrs K M Goater, R S Mc Gregor, Miss N Moore, Ms L Webb, Ms J H Smith.

Red Gregory’s last race event was at 06/04/2017 and it has not been nominated for any upcoming race.

Red Gregory Racing Form

Career form is wins, 2 seconds, thirds from 3 starts with a lifetime career prize money of $2,375.

With a 0% Win Percentage and 67% Place Percentage. Red Gregory's last race event was at Albany.

Exposed form for its last starts is 2-2-6 .
